Ver Mensaje Individual
  #5 (permalink)  
Antiguo 16/03/2012, 14:18
alfeyo
 
Fecha de Ingreso: mayo-2003
Mensajes: 18
Antigüedad: 21 años, 6 meses
Puntos: 3
Respuesta: SQL para obtener últimos registros

Gracias por contestar,
le puse servicios pero también puede llamarles ventas.

las llamadas son independientes de los servicios
es decir le pueden llamar al cliente n veces y este no tener algún servicio (es decir pueden llamar al cliente para ofrecerle una promoción)

la llamada solo es atendida solo un empleado pero un cliente puede recibir llamadas de varios empleados generando un registro por cada llamada, asi como en la tabla llamadas el cliente 1058 que tiene 3 llamadas de 2 distintas personas.

la tabla servicio y cont_servicio funcionan como una factura en servicio van datos generales y en cont_servicio va el artículo comprado.

lo que busco es ver si en un solo query puedo sacar la última llamada hecha y el último servicio por cada cliente y que este haya tenido el servicio por ejemplo de frenos.

y me devuelva mas o menos este resultado:

Código:
CLIENTE|ATIENDE|FECHA_LLAM      |FECHA_SERV  |SERVICIO
123    |JUAN   |2011-11-03 08:40|2011-12-07  |FRENOS
1058   |RINGO  |2011-11-12 09:00|2011-11-06  |FRENOS
donde me da que juan fue el ultimo que llamo al cliente 123 y su ultimo servicio de frenos fue el 2011-12-07